Another safe and successful dive trip! I have eliminated the camera fogging issues I had during my trip to the Philippines. However, U/W photography is very different from standard photography and I am still working out my system. My biggest problem now is sharpness and color. My friend said his U/W photos showed the color a lot better than my digital camera showed. My friend is using a 35mm instamatic U/W "Reef Master" camera but we think the big difference is in the external strobe he is using. An external strobe should help if not fix my color and sharpness issues.
